Quick Answer

I notice the translation I generated has significant quality issues with Tamil script encoding and grammatical errors. Rather than write a corrupted file, let me reconsider the approach.

The prior session notes indicate that direct Tamil character output from Claude experiences encoding issues and grammatical inconsistencies. Given this known issue, I should not proceed with writing a file that would contain corrupted Tamil text.

The core problem: I can generate Tamil text, but there's evidence from the session history (observations S2545-S2554) that the output contains encoding corruption and quality issues. Writing a file with defective Tamil would create more work for you to fix.

What I recommend:

  1. Use the Claude Code CLI directly with a smaller section to verify encoding works cleanly before doing the full article
  2. Or break the translation into sections (frontmatter, intro, each section) and verify each piece separately
  3. Or use a specialized Tamil translation tool that guarantees proper Unicode handling

Would you like me to:

  • Test a small section (e.g., just the title and intro paragraph) via Claude CLI to verify encoding works?
  • Break the translation into smaller chunks that you can review individually?
  • Something else?